1.2 The Necessity of Cross-Chain Technology

In the blockchain ecosystem, there are multiple different chains, each with its unique characteristics and purposes. However, due to the isolation between chains, asset transfer and communication have become difficult. Cross-chain technology has emerged to break down these barriers and effectively connect assets and information across different chains.

The working principle of cross-chain operations.

3.1 The Concept of Cross-Chain Bridges

Cross-chain bridge is the infrastructure for transferring assets between different blockchains. Users interact with the cross-chain bridge through Bitpie to complete asset exchanges.

3.2 Technical Implementation

The technical team at Bitpie has designed a smart contract mechanism that can identify user operation requests and effectively manage the flow of cross-chain assets. Whether it's transfers, exchanges, or other operations, they are all automatically executed through smart contracts to ensure the security and efficiency of the operations.

3.3 Transaction Verification Mechanism

In cross-chain operations, the validity and reliability of transactions are crucial. By utilizing consensus mechanisms and multi-signature technology, Bitpie ensures the authenticity and effectiveness of cross-chain transactions, reducing the possibility of fraud and errors.

Four, the steps of Bitpie cross-chain operation.

4.1 Preparations

Before conducting cross-chain operations, users need to ensure that they have created and set up a wallet in Bitpie, and have deposited the required assets for the chain.

4.2 Select Cross-Chain Operation

Users select the cross-chain operation they need to perform in Bitpie, such as converting Ethereum to Polkadot assets. After making the selection, users need to input the information and quantity of the target chain.

4.3 Confirmation and Execution

After confirming that the operation information is correct, users can submit the application. Once the transaction is confirmed by the blockchain network, the required assets will be automatically transferred to the target chain address.

4.4 Completing the Transaction

Once the transaction is completed, the user will receive a notification from Bitpie. At this point, they can check the assets that have been credited to their personal wallet, and the entire process will be complete.

Frequently Asked Questions

  • Which blockchains does Bitpie support?
  • Bitpie currently supports multiple mainstream blockchains such as Ethereum, Bitcoin, Polkadot, and BSC, and users can choose corresponding assets according to their needs.

  • How to ensure the security of cross-chain operations?
  • Users should use the security features of Bitpie, including biometric recognition and multi-signature functionality, while also regularly updating the application to stay current with the latest security trends.

  • How long does it take to complete a cross-chain operation?
  • The specific time for cross-chain operations depends on the congestion level of the blockchain network, typically ranging from a few minutes to several tens of minutes, but may be extended during peak periods.

  • Do cross-chain operations require payment?
  • Yes, users need to pay on-chain transaction fees when performing cross-chain operations, and the specific fees vary depending on the different chains and transaction volumes.

  • Is there any risk?
  • Despite providing multiple security mechanisms, cross-chain operations may still face risks such as contract vulnerabilities and network congestion. Users should increase their awareness of these risks.
